Paleo Chicken Soup.

The classic chicken soup can prove to be an incredibly immune-boosting Paleo recipe. Chicken is packed with immune-boosting nutrients such as vitamin B6. The broth or stock made from boiling chicken bones contains gelatin, chondroitin, and other vital nutrients helpful for gut healing and immunity. Add in a lot of finely chopped vegetables like carrots, onions, and bell peppers for a nutrient-rich soup.

Ingredients:

  • 1 whole chicken

  • 3 carrots, chopped

  • 2 onions, chopped

  • 2 bell peppers, chopped

  • Salt and pepper to taste

  • Instructions:

  • Boil the chicken in a large pot of water for around 1 hour.

  • Remove the chicken, let it cool then shred the meat.

  • In the same broth, add the vegetables and simmer until they’re soft.

  • Add the shredded chicken back to the pot.

  • Season with salt and pepper, then serve.

Garlic Shrimp Stir Fry.

Garlic is known for its immune-boosting properties due to its high concentration of sulfuric compounds, such as allicin. Combined with the lean high-protein shrimp, you’ll have a tasty immune-boosting Paleo delight.

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ined

  • 10 cloves garlic, minced

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

  • Salt and pepper to taste

  • 1 tablespoon fresh chopped parsley

  • Instructions:

  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at.

  • Add the garlic and sauté until fragrant.

  • Add the shrimp, salt, and pepper and cook until shrimp turn pink.

  • Gar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ving.

Berry Smoothie.

Berries are a great source of vitamin C and antioxidants which are crucial for immune health. This smoothie recipe, featuring a mix of berries, banana, and almond milk, is a perfect and quick Paleo breakfast or snack.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up mixed fresh or frozen berries

  • 1 ripe banana

  • 1 cup unsweetened almond milk

  • Instructions:

  • Add all ingredients to a blender.

  • Blend until smooth.

  • Serve immediately.
